Coefficient Of Friction Of 1-day Acuvue® Trueye® And Acuvue® Oasys® Brands Comparable To The Human Cornea, Study Shows

BIRMINGHAM, UK (June 12, 2014) – The coefficient of friction (CoF) of 1-DAY ACUVUE® TruEye® Brand Contact Lenses (narafilcon A) and of ACUVUE® OASYS® Brand Contact Lenses (senofilcon A) were found to be comparable to that of the human cornea, according to new research presented at the 2014 British Contact Lens Association Clinical Conference (BCLA). The data demonstrated no statistically significant difference between CoF of human corneal tissue and 1-DAY ACUVUE® TruEye® Brand and ACUVUE® OASYS® Brand Contact Lenses at study baseline or following 18 hours of simulated wear.

“These results suggest that the lens surface of these two contact lens brands is as lubricious as the human cornea,” says Tawnya Wilson, O.D., Principal Research Optometrist at Johnson & Johnson Vision Care, Inc. “This is important because coefficient of friction has previously been shown to be one factor highly correlated with contact lens comfort1,2. 1-DAY ACUVUE® TruEye® and ACUVUE® OASYS® seem to mimic corneal properties that may help address end-of-day comfort for many of our patients.”

About the Study

CoF testing was conducted on 1-DAY ACUVUE® TruEye® and ACUVUE® OASYS® Brand Contact Lenses directly out of the package (0-hour) utilising a micro-tribometer in a tear-like fluid with phosphate buffer saline (300-310 mOsm/kg). The applied normal force varied between 0.25 and 4.0 mN with a measured stroke length of 1.0mm at normal blink speed of 0.1mm per second. A mucin-coated glass disc was used as counter surface mimicking the inner eyelid. A simulated aged cycling (18-hour) of the contact lenses was also completed using the same measurement methodology. The results were compared to CoF of human corneal tissue recently published using the same methodology3, and statistical analysis was conducted using an analysis of variance (ANOVA).

This study found that the 1-DAY ACUVUE® TruEye® LS mean (SD) 0-hour CoF was 0.0080 (0.001140) (N=13) and 0.0098 (0.002055) at 18-hour (N=4). ACUVUE® OASYS® LS mean (SD) 0-hour CoF was 0.0104 (0.001300) (N=10) and 0.0116 (0.001300) at 18-hour (N=10). The CoF of human corneal tissue is 0.0153 (0.002974).

Dunnett’s t-tests on least squares means from the ANOVA model revealed no statistical differences at 0.05 significance level between corneal tissue and each study contact lens at 0-hour and 18-hour: 1-DAY ACUVUE® TruEye® (0-hour) vs. cornea -0.007 (StdErr 0.003) (p=0.067); 1-DAY ACUVUE® TruEye® (18-hour) vs. cornea -0.006 (StdErr 0.004) (p=0.27); ACUVUE® OASYS® (0-hour) vs. cornea -0.005 (StdErr 0.003) (p=0.281); and, ACUVUE® OASYS® (18-hour) vs. cornea -0.004 (StdErr 0.003) (p=0.479).

Source: Wilson, T, Aeschlimann, R, Tosatti, S, Toubouti, Y, Kakkassery, J, Osborn-Lorenz, K, “Comparison of Frictional Behavior of Human Corneal Tissue and Silicone Hydrogel Contact Lenses.” Poster presented June 7, 2014 at the 2014 British Contact Lens Association Clinical Conference
